Marco Daniel Rusterholz, 49, of Goodwood, has pleaded not guilty to murdering Joshua Newman and Angela Hallam in August 2012.
The couple's bodies were found partially burnt and containing stab wounds in their Pioneer Parade home.
David Ronald Morgan, 55 , who has pleaded not guilty to conspiring to murder Ms Hallam, also appeared in court via video today.
Their matters were adjourned to June 10.
